Market Insight

Shell Cove, a coastal NSW suburb, commands a premium house price of roughly $1.45 million, with 7.4–7.8% annual growth over the past year. Demand rests on coastal location and community appeal, supporting 126–129 house sales annually. Houses take 78–113 days to sell. Units underperform: median prices of $1.16–$1.29 million, with growth of -6% to -11.8%. Gross yields are thin: houses 3.1–3.2%, units 3.1–3.9%. Weekly rents: houses $878–$900, units $800–$825. The market is near long-term trend, fairly valued as of early 2026. Future gains hinge on coastal scarcity and community factors, but high entry prices and unit softness temper upside.
